At the shop they said they only have to mill it a few thou and I'll have it back tomorrow :) But onto my question now - do you guys know if it's possible (without too much troubles) to put the head back on with the engine in the car if I use ARP studs? |
its easy... put the head on, THEN put the studs in.... its only hard if you put the studs in first, then attempt to drop the head on... |
